Articles of ios

Reduciendo el espacio entre las secciones de UITableView

¿Hay alguna manera de reducir el espacio entre dos secciones de una UITableView? Hay aproximadamente 15 píxeles entre cada sección que tengo. Ya intenté devolver 0 para -tableView:heightForFooterInSection: y -tableView:heightForHeaderInSection: pero eso no cambia nada. ¿Alguna sugerencia?

Compatibilidad con el elemento de menú Abrir en … en mi aplicación para iOS Mail And Safari

Necesito que mi aplicación abra documentos desde las aplicaciones Safari y Mail con esa cosa “Abrir en …” en la clase UIDocumentInteractionController . ¿Cómo logro esto?

Códigos de error NSURLErrorDomain sin documentar (-1001, -1003 y -1004) con StoreKit

Estoy escribiendo código relacionado con StoreKit, y estoy obteniendo algunos códigos de error bastante preocupantes cuando trato de agregar una compra a la cola. Hasta ahora, he experimentado los códigos de error -1003 y -1004 y no puedo encontrar nada acerca de esos códigos en Internet. La ejecución de una solicitud de producto devuelve números […]

¿Recibe una notificación cuando UITableView ha terminado de solicitar datos?

¿Hay alguna forma de averiguar cuándo una UITableView ha terminado de solicitar datos de su fuente de datos? Ninguno de los viewDidLoad / viewWillAppear / viewDidAppear del controlador de vista asociado ( UITableViewController ) son útiles aquí, ya que todos se UITableViewController demasiado pronto. Ninguno de ellos (comprensiblemente) garantiza que las consultas a la fuente […]

Enlace condicional: si deja error: el inicializador para el enlace condicional debe tener un tipo opcional

Estoy intentando eliminar una fila de mi fuente de datos y la siguiente línea de código: if let tv = tableView { causa el siguiente error: El inicializador para el enlace condicional debe tener el tipo opcional, no UITableView Aquí está el código completo: // Override to support editing the table view. func tableView(tableView: UITableView, […]

Animar una vista de imagen para deslizarse hacia arriba

Estoy intentando hacer que una vista de imagen ( logo continuación) se desplace hacia arriba en 100 píxeles. Estoy usando este código, pero nada sucede en absoluto: [UIView beginAnimations:nil context:nil]; [UIView setAnimationDuration:3]; logo.center = CGPointMake(logo.center.x, logo.center.y – 100); [UIView commitAnimations]; Este código está en el método viewDidLoad . Específicamente, el logo.center = … no está […]

En iOS6, problemas para forzar ViewController a cierta interfaceOrientation cuando se empuja en la stack

Tengo la siguiente configuración de controlador de vista: viewController1 puede rotar libremente a cualquier orientación, excepto el retrato al revés. viewController2 se coloca encima de viewController1, y me gustaría que fuera la misma orientación que viewController1 y me gustaría que no pueda rotar. viewController3 se coloca encima de viewController2. Me gustaría que viewController3 esté en […]

Cuándo usar Storyboard y cuándo usar XIB

¿Hay alguna guía sobre cuándo usar storyboards en un proyecto iOS y cuándo usar XIB? ¿Cuáles son los pros y contras de cada uno y qué situaciones les conviene cada uno? Cerca de lo que puedo decir, no está tan limpio usar los guiones del guión gráfico cuando tienes controles de vista empujados por elementos […]

El teclado numérico de UITextField: punto en lugar de coma para los valores float

Estoy usando un textField que se llena desde un teclado numérico. El problema es que, con muchos formatos de región local (todos europeos, por ejemplo), el teclado numérico de UITextField tiene coma en lugar de punto, así que cada vez que escribo un número decimal, UITextField no puede reconocer la coma decimal y el número […]

¿Cómo puedo cambiar el color de los puntos de paginación de UIPageControl?

Estoy desarrollando una aplicación en la que deseo cambiar el color o la imagen de los puntos de paginación de UIPageControl . ¿Cómo puedo cambiarlo? ¿Es posible personalizar UIpageControl en el escenario anterior?